Output 58ba0bfbb66b63c6dfcdddeb667c11fa5d06a1bbd9fd2ae9672bbbc45e8d3570:1

value
17004895
script pubkey
OP_0 OP_PUSHBYTES_32 7104346f706f1f58d034adf18c67d9a09b9cf1f8f8ef877c9a8c48c7880d1755
address
bc1qwyzrgmmsdu0435p54hccce7e5zdeeu0clrhcwly633yv0zqdza2s62hshz
transaction
58ba0bfbb66b63c6dfcdddeb667c11fa5d06a1bbd9fd2ae9672bbbc45e8d3570
confirmations
135180
spent
true